samba pdc roaming profiles help


Hello all, i use a samba 3.0.14a pdc with roaming profiles support and clients are winxp pro. As microsoft writes, profiles are copied locally when user logs in and merged and updated back to server when user logs out. I want when the user logs in not to copy the profile but use it *directly* from the server. e.g: When i touch a file from the shell, this file to appear immediatelly in the user's desktop. (supposing i am typing this in the user's desktop directory). my smb.conf follows:
[global]
netbios name = redhat
server string = Samba %v on %L
workgroup = net2day
os level = 65
prefered master = yes
domain master = yes
local master = yes
domain logons = yes
socket options = TCP_NODELAY IPTOS_LOWDELAY SO_SNDBUF=8192 SO_RCVBUF=8192
time server = yes
hide dot files = yes
client code page = 852
character set = ISO8859-2
security = user
guest ok = no
invalid users = bin deamon sys man postfix mail ftp
admin users = @wheel
logon drive = H:
logon home = \\redhat\%u
domain admin group = @wheel
encrypt passwords = yes
log level = 2
log file = /var/log/samba/log.%L
max log size = 1000
debug timestamp = yes
syslog = 1
logon path = \\%N\profiles\%u

logon script = logon.bat
csc policy = disable
add user script = /usr/sbin/useradd -d /dev/null -g 100 -s /bin/false -M %u
[netlogon]
path = /home/samba/netlogon
public = no
writeable = no
browsable = no
valid users = root @smbusers
[profiles]
path = /home/samba/profiles/
writeable = yes
create mask = 0700
directory mask = 0700
browsable = no
[public]
comment = public
path = /home/public
browseable = yes
public = yes
guest ok = yes
writeable = yes

Any help appreciated

Yes you can do this!

Look up "Folder Redirection" in http://www.google.com/ .

That'll be what your looking for. To give a demo, Right-Click My Documents on the Desktop, And that should give you some idea of what I'm talking about......"Target Folder Location" is what you want. It's pretty easy to do from there .
